About Lake Charles
Immigration Cases in Lake Charles, LA
Immigration law in Lake Charles serves a vibrant multicultural community, including established populations from Vietnam, Honduras, and other nations who have made Southwest Louisiana home. The region's petrochemical industry and proximity to the Texas border create unique immigration scenarios involving work visas, family reunification, and border-related issues. Local attorneys must understand both federal immigration law and Louisiana's specific requirements for issues like driver's licenses, in-state tuition, and professional licensing for immigrants.

Local Courts
Immigration cases in Lake Charles are typically handled through the New Orleans Immigration Court and the U.S. District Court for the Western District of Louisiana, Lake Charles Division.

How long does it take to get an immigration hearing in Lake Charles?
Immigration court hearings for Lake Charles residents are scheduled through the New Orleans Immigration Court, where current backlogs mean cases may take 2-4 years to reach trial. However, attorneys can file motions to expedite cases involving medical emergencies or other urgent circumstances.
